The need for a certificate of participation arises frequently across diverse sectors. In education, it’s often required for student participation in research projects or for demonstrating completion of a course. In the workplace, it’s frequently used to acknowledge employee training, certification, or participation in company initiatives. Furthermore, in volunteer organizations, it’s a standard requirement for demonstrating commitment and adherence to program guidelines. The specific purpose of a certificate of participation varies greatly depending on the context, but its core function remains consistent: to formally record and validate participation. Let’s delve into the different types of certificates of participation. Firstly, there’s the standard, general certificate, often used for broader participation. These certificates typically outline the program or event’s objectives and the participant’s role within it. They are frequently used in corporate training programs or community outreach initiatives. Secondly, there are specialized certificates designed for specific projects or initiatives. For example, a certification for completing a cybersecurity training course would be a specialized certificate, reflecting the specific skills and knowledge gained. These certificates often include detailed assessments and validation processes. Finally, there are digital certificates, often generated electronically, offering a convenient and easily shareable option. These are frequently used for online courses, webinars, or participation in virtual events. The choice of certificate type depends entirely on the nature of the participation and the desired level of formality.
Understanding the Requirements for a Certificate of Participation
Before embarking on the creation of a certificate of participation, it’s crucial to understand the specific requirements outlined by the organization or program issuing it. These requirements can vary significantly depending on the context. Common requirements include:
- Purpose: Clearly define the purpose of the certificate. What is it intended to demonstrate?
- Participant Information: Collect accurate and complete information about the participant, including their name, contact details, and participation date.
- Program/Event Details: Provide a detailed description of the program or event the certificate pertains to.
- Verification Process: Outline the verification process used to validate the participant’s involvement. This may involve a checklist, assessment, or approval from a designated authority.
- Format and Design: Specify the desired format and design of the certificate. Consider using professional printing and design services to ensure a polished and credible appearance.
- Legal Compliance: Ensure the certificate complies with all relevant legal and regulatory requirements.
Key Sections for a Comprehensive Certificate of Participation
A well-structured certificate of participation typically includes the following sections:
-
Header and Logo: The certificate should begin with a clear header containing the organization’s logo and the certificate title. This provides immediate visual recognition and establishes credibility.
-
Participant Information: This section provides detailed information about the participant, including their full name, contact details (email, phone number), and potentially their affiliation with the organization.
-
Program/Event Details: A comprehensive description of the program or event the certificate pertains to is essential. This should include the date, location, objectives, and key activities.
-
Verification Process: This is a critical section outlining how the certificate was validated. This might include a checklist of activities, a scoring system, or a review by a designated authority. Be specific about the criteria used for validation.
-
Certificate Details: This section provides essential information about the certificate itself, such as the certificate number, date of issue, and validity period.
-
Terms and Conditions: Include a brief statement outlining the terms and conditions of the certificate, such as any limitations or restrictions.
-
Signature and Approval: A signature from a designated authority (e.g., program coordinator, manager) is typically required to formally approve the certificate.
